Obama took office in January the markets made their lows for the year in April. Along with that Monster.com Job index showed lows in the same time frame. What did he do in the month and a half in office to bring on those lows? The damage was done long before and the blame doesn't necessarily fall on politicians it falls on greed of wall street and our corporate leaders. Since these morons rarely think about more than the next quarter and their options. The in thing to do is outsource your jobs and bring in H1B's to replace your workers. What they have missed is that the money they are saving is leaving our economy. They are basically firing their customers or their customers customer. But thats ok since this props their stock for a bit and they can cashout. We have evolved into strip-mining our economy and future. Unfortunately Capitalisim is not a deomocracy, it has evolved into a dictatorship where those at the very top pillage those that are not. And we are deluded into thinking that getting an education and working hard will get us into that top .01 percent...
